概括
这项研究表明,一系列网络研讨会改善了脊髓损伤 (SCI) 患者对残疾的认识和看法. 该倡议可用于长期使用,具有更广泛覆盖的潜力.

背景情况:
- COVID-19扰乱了脊髓损伤 (SCI) 患者的基本卫生服务.
- 开发了一种基于网络研讨会的新策略,以改善SCI社区获得自我管理信息的机会.
- 以前在SCI管理中使用远程医疗强调了关于网络研讨会结果的学术差距.
研究的目的:
- 评估SCI患者的一系列网络研讨会的成果.
- 确定对社会联系和残疾感知的影响和影响.
- 探索网络研讨会倡议的长期可持续性.
主要方法:
- 采用基于社区的参与策略的融合混合方法设计.
- 来自弹出式问题,网络研讨会后调查和YouTube分析的定量数据.
- 从与SCI个人和医疗保健提供者的半结构面试中获得的定性数据.
主要成果:
- 234人参加了6个网络研讨会,13.2%的人完成了调查,23%的人接受了采访.
- 网络研讨会主要针对有SCI的人和卫生专业人员,主要是在城市地区.
- 知识被认为是有效和有用的;加强了现有的SCI社区,并积极影响了残疾人的看法.
结论:
- 网络研讨会系列增强了参与者的知识,并改善了对SCI后残疾的看法.
- 长期实施是可行的,但需要战略来增加农村的覆盖范围和多样性.
- 网络研讨会的格式是高度可用的和可访问的,加强了SCI社区.

The Spinal Cord
29.4K
The spinal cord is the body’s major nerve tract of the central nervous system, communicating afferent sensory information from the periphery to the brain and efferent motor information from the brain to the body. The human spinal cord extends from the hole at the base of the skull, or foramen magnum, to the level of the first or second lumbar vertebra.
